This APP works as it should, I have a ring camera also so I have that for comparison. Only a couple things I could think of to improve the app. If there was a way to set Customized monitoring functions to Customized time periods, to allow for higher/lower sensitivities and changes to recording length depending on schedule. Second thing is that notifications are a little slow, but I think that's probably the camera's hardware and not the app.
Camera display is excellent. Cloud storage not working. I have the free 3 day storage option and although I receive several notifications throughout the day, there is only ever,at most, one video saved. Sometimes, on going to view videos, several videos appear then instantly scroll up and disappear. No response from developer or o-kam so will probably return the camera. 3 stars is for the display.
Good. Stable so far, and the HD plus smooth continuous zoom features are far superior than the old Eye4 app developed for the same Vstarcam cameras. O-KAM's UI is also clearer and easier to use, because the instructions are written in better English than the weird literal translations from Chinese seen in Eye4. Unfortunately the 2-way audio intercom feature is practically unusable, as the sound quality is very poor despite using fast WiFi. Perhaps the developer could improve the audio codecs.
